    Ricoh mp 4000

    anyone have install instructions for the fax system on the mp4000? Seems plug and play but not working

    Re: Ricoh mp 4000

    It is plug and play (assuming you have the right one). However, the issue is most liekly that the MBU is not tightly 'plugged' to FCU so it doesn't load, or shows SC672.

                    Re: Ricoh mp 4000

                    Originally posted by mrfuser
                    D3465132a says on the board.

                    Cant seem to upload pics from iPhone anymore.
                    That is the correct FCU board, but what MBU board is mounted on it? The MBU is where the FAX program is loaded. If it missing, incorrect or defective the FAX function will not be shown.

                            Re: Ricoh mp 4000

                            As mentioned, make sure the small blue jumper on the fax board is set to ON. Even on machines with the board installed at the warehouse the jumper can be forgotten and you just have to change it.
                            Just slide the unit out and you should be able to see the jumper towards the bottom. It will have "ON" "OFF" in very fine print on either side of a 3-pin jumper.
